When should I book my B&B in Saratoga Springs?
When you’re planning your trip to Saratoga Springs,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 71°F, while the coldest months are January and December with an average of 28°F. The snowiest months in Saratoga Springs are January, April, February, and March, with each month seeing an average of 10 inches of snowfall.

How can I get to and around Saratoga Springs?
You can map out your trip in and around Saratoga Springs ahead of time with these transportation options. Fly into Provo, UT (PVU), which is located 13.6 mi (21.8 km) from the city center. Otherwise, you can search for flights to Salt Lake City International Airport (SLC), which is 30.5 mi (49 km) away. If you’d like to explore around the area, consider renting a car to take in more sights.
